public final class TransformRandomAccess<T> extends AbstractLocalizable implements RandomAccess<T>
Wrap asourceRandomAccess which is related to this by a genericTransformtransformToSource.TransformRandomAccessgets called byCursorimplementations overRandomAccessthat initialize at theIntervalmin position - 1, i.e. they callbck(0)aftersetPosition(min). Transforms are not necessarily defined at this position and may throw an exception. Therefore, position update must not apply the transformation! Instead, the transformation is applied atget(). So don't callget()more than once at the same place (generally a good idea).
